Letter of Introduction 

My theory of writing, or the general circumstances that I like to work in, has changed drastically after coming in this semester. Before this semester started for me, I’d always try to work in the morning and get over with as much work as I possibly could. But, if that did not go as planned or if I didn’t have the motivation to do so, I would occasionally stay up late nights and do my work then. With such a hard transition between being able to create a more flexible schedule, and also having school online, trying to find the right environment for me to work at was a bit difficult. The pandemic drained a lot of my motivation as well which was another factor that made things more difficult for me. So, throughout this semester, I tried plenty of things. I tried working from home, whether that was early in the morning or late at night. And other times, I would work early on campus in any quiet environment that I could find, which actually ended up working the best for me. Then, when I would arrive home later in the day, I would try to keep a consistent routine, that way I could keep up my energy and motivation. Of course, it didn’t always work on some days, but it was something I was able to develop and help me out through the semester.

As I feel like this was the core for this class, one objective that I believe was significant to me was being able to explore and analyze variety and genres and rhetorical situations. I believe the process can really be seen in my Composition in Two Genres since it allowed me to use a variety of genres. When creating both pieces, I had to think about how each element of that genre will help me toward my goal or purpose of my writing which I talk about in my “Reflection” section. I had to make sure they were “appealing towards my audience.” I find this objective is meaningful to me considering how it’s changed how I’ve approached writing. It has taught me to really look through different aspects of my writing and see if those aspects are helping me achieve my goal. Not only that but it’s also helped me analyze it in other pieces as well. 

Another objective that was significant to me throughout this semester was being able to engage in collaborative and social aspects of the writing process. Throughout this semester, I’ve spoken to many of my peers or other students whether it was assisting them with their work or even getting feedback on mine. Not only that, but I’ve also used the help and experience of my peers to even strengthen some of my essays. In my Inquiry-Based Essay, I have a section known as “The Interview Section” where I spoke to friends and family about their experiences throughout the pandemic. Using those responses helped me gather a strong response to my initial question of the essay. This objective is important to me because I almost see it as a reminder that not everything has to be done alone. You have peers around you who are willing to help you through your writing process and it can really strengthen the work you already have. 

An objective that I believe should be significant to almost everyone is being able to properly find and locate credible sources. Apart from my own experiences and the experiences of peers around me, I did not have a general idea of how social isolation and the pandemic mentally affected other teenagers around the nation. If I wanted a better grasp, I had to go through other sources and studies in order so that I can gain a more broad and in-depth answer to my initial question. This can really be seen throughout all of the work I’ve done through this semester. From my analysis of a variety of sources to even my Inquiry-Based Essay, where I use sources to back up my statements such as citing studies from Unicef and etc, you can see me utilizing this skill. Being able to properly locate and use sources is a meaningful skill to me since it’s something I can rely on to find answers to any of my potential questions and expand my horizon of knowledge.
